Liverpool legend Carragher: Klopp needs to buy

Liverpool legend Jamie Carragher says they must buy before the transfer deadline falls.

Carragher has urged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p to sign a couple of players this summer.

When asked if he'd be happy if Liverpool didn't sign anyone else, Carragher told Off The Ball: “No, I'd like them to bring someone in. I still think we're a little bit short at left-back, [Alberto] Moreno's gone.

“I still think a creative midfield player. The front three is a difficult one for managers and clubs when you've got such a set front three.

“They've got a young lad in Brewster, probably one of the best talents in Europe for his age. Origi, the goals he's scored.

“To bring another one in and spend £50m or £60m, Origi has just signed a new contract so they will have had to promise him in some ways, a lot of chances.

“The same with Brewster, I think he was maybe looking at moving abroad [last year] like a lot of young English players now.

“In some ways, In some ways, they've got to give these players a chance. I understand from a manager's point of view it's not easy.

“But Liverpool will spend big if the right player is there, they proved that last season with the keeper and [Virgil] van Dijk. It's not a case of that."
